Clear-Com President Bob Boster talks with Steve Waskul in the StudioXperience Broadcast Studio at the 2018 NAB Show. Clear-Com has a long history of communications excellence and the company is celebrating it’s 50th anniversary this year.

One new innovation discussed is the new FreeSpeak II IP Transceiver. The IP Transceiver is one of two products that debuted based on Clear-Com’s new IP Platform solution that features AES67 compatibility, low-latency signal distribution, high performance audio routing with high audio bandwidth. With this innovation FreeSpeak II wireless beltpacks can now be addressed across a user’s LAN.

About Clear-Com

Clear-Com, an HME company, is a global provider of professional real-time communications solutions and services since 1968. They innovate market proven technologies that link people together through wired and wireless systems.

Clear-Com was first to market portable wired and wireless intercom systems for live performances. Since then, their history of technological advancements and innovations has delivered significant improvements to the way people collaborate in professional settings where real-time communication matters. For the markets they serve — broadcast, live performance, live events, sports, military, aerospace and government– Clear-Com communication products have consistently met the demands for high quality audio, reliability, scalability and low latency, while addressing communication requirements of varying size and complexity.
